Phlebitis is associated with distressing symptoms, including localized pain, swelling, and inflammation. If left untreated, it may lead to serious complications such as pulmonary embolism and sepsis, both of which can be life-threatening.
What is phlebitis?
Veins are responsible for returning deoxygenated blood from peripheral tissues back to the heart. Phlebitis is defined as inflammation of the venous wall, often resulting from structural damage or functional impairment of the vessel, leading to pain, swelling, and inflammatory changes. It is a commonly encountered condition within the spectrum of peripheral vascular diseases.
Depending on the characteristics and anatomical location of the affected veins, phlebitis is broadly classified into two main categories:
Superficial phlebitis: Superficial veins are located just beneath the skin, are relatively small in caliber, and are often visible to the naked eye. Superficial phlebitis is commonly associated with external factors, such as intravenous catheter placement or local mechanical irritation. This condition is generally self-limiting and may resolve once the triggering factor is removed.
Deep vein phlebitis: Deep veins are situated within the muscle compartments of the upper or lower extremities, are larger in size, and contain valves that facilitate unidirectional blood flow toward the heart. Deep vein phlebitis is most frequently associated with thrombus formation within the vessel lumen, leading to deep vein thrombosis (DVT) and subsequent inflammatory changes.

Early signs and symptoms of phlebitis to recognize
Phlebitis commonly occurs in the upper and lower extremities, as these areas are distal from the heart and are subjected to increased mechanical stress and frequent physical activity. Key clinical manifestations of phlebitis include:
Pain
Patients with phlebitis, whether involving superficial or deep veins, typically experience localized pain at the affected site. The discomfort may limit mobility and significantly impact daily activities. Pain associated with deep vein involvement is generally more severe than that of superficial phlebitis and tends to worsen with movement or physical exertion.
Fever
In more severe cases, particularly when associated with infection, phlebitis may present with systemic symptoms such as fever and generalized fatigue.
Inflammatory signs
Phlebitis presents with classic features of inflammation similar to those observed in other tissues. The affected area may exhibit swelling, edema, increased warmth upon palpation, and changes in skin coloration. In cases of superficial phlebitis, these signs are often clearly visible on clinical inspection.
Patients frequently experience persistent pain localized to the affected vein.
Pulmonary manifestations
If phlebitis is associated with thrombus migration to the pulmonary circulation, it may result in pulmonary embolism or pulmonary infarction. Clinical manifestations include dyspnea, tachycardia, and hemoptysis. These symptoms are indicative of a potentially life-threatening condition and require prompt hospitalization and urgent medical intervention to prevent severe complications.
Etiology of phlebitis
The causes of phlebitis vary depending on whether the condition involves superficial or deep veins.
Superficial phlebitis is commonly associated with:
Local trauma
Infection
Intravenous (IV) catheter insertion
Formation of small thrombi
Injection of irritating or vesicant medications into the vein
Deep vein phlebitis may result from:
Vascular injury or irritation due to surgery, fractures, or a prior history of deep vein thrombosis (DVT)
Hypercoagulable states related to medications, malignancy, or inherited coagulation disorders
Reduced venous blood flow secondary to prolonged immobility or sedentary lifestyle
Risk factors for phlebitis
Several factors may increase the risk of developing phlebitis, including:
Coagulation disorders
Previous history of deep vein thrombosis (DVT)
Pregnancy
Overweight and obesity
Prolonged immobility or sedentary behavior
Regular use of oral contraceptives or hormone replacement therapy
Malignancy
Chronic tobacco use
Age over 60 years
Excessive alcohol consumption
These factors significantly elevate the likelihood of developing phlebitis compared to the general population.
Overweight increases the risk of phlebitis due to increased mechanical load and pressure on the venous system.
Is phlebitis a serious condition?
Phlebitis is generally not considered a highly life-threatening condition and rarely leads to severe complications. However, it can cause skin lesions that may predispose to infection, potentially progressing to bloodstream infection (sepsis) if not appropriately managed.
Importantly, a serious complication of phlebitis is pulmonary embolism, which may present with dyspnea, pleuritic chest pain, tachycardia, and hemoptysis. This condition requires prompt hospital evaluation and early intervention to prevent life-threatening outcomes.
Diagnostic approaches for phlebitis
Phlebitis can often be initially diagnosed based on clinical evaluation, including physical examination and a thorough medical history. In addition, to establish a definitive diagnosis, patients may undergo the following investigations:
Blood tests: Laboratory investigations help assess D-dimer levels and identify underlying coagulation disorders.
Limb ultrasound: Doppler ultrasonography is used to evaluate venous blood flow and detect abnormalities in the veins and arteries.
Computed tomography (CT) or magnetic resonance imaging (MRI): These imaging modalities are performed to detect the presence of thrombi and assess the extent of vascular involvement.
Common treatment approaches for phlebitis
Although phlebitis is not typically a life-threatening condition, early treatment is recommended to relieve symptoms and prevent potential complications.
In cases of superficial phlebitis, management may include the application of warm compresses, administration of antibiotics if infection is suspected, and removal of the intravenous (IV) catheter when applicable.
For deep vein phlebitis, anticoagulant therapy is the mainstay of treatment. In cases where the condition significantly impairs blood circulation, patients may be considered for thrombectomy or other interventional procedures to restore venous flow.
Preventive measures
Phlebitis can be effectively prevented by proactively adopting the following measures:
Ambulate as early as possible after surgery to avoid prolonged immobility
Perform regular leg stretching and avoid maintaining flexed leg positions for extended periods, which may impair venous circulation
Maintain adequate daily hydration
Adhere strictly to prescribed medications, including anticoagulants when indicated
Undergo routine cardiovascular evaluations and inform healthcare providers of any existing risk factors
